Input validation error in Puppet Firewall Module - CVE-2022-0675
Published: June 27, 2022
Vulnerability details
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to in certain situations it is possible for an unmanaged rule to exist on the target system that has the same comment as the rule specified in the manifest.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ted input to the application and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
Affected software
Red Hat OpenStack
puppet-firewall (Red Hat package)
How to mitigate CVE-2022-0675
Red Hat OpenStack - addressed in versions 16.1.9, 16.2.3
puppet-firewall (Red Hat package) - update to 3.4.0-1.94f707cgit.el8ost
